Versatility is a crucial element for many companies across the modern business environment. Being versatile to moving markets, burgeoning technology and new business practices can make a business more flexible in its strategic outlook and general efficiency. One example of a widespread adaptable business technique would be portfolio diversity. This is a fund management method involving the spreading out of asset direct exposure across a portfolio. Among the excellent benefits of portfolio diversification is that it makes you less reliant on any particular financial investment, bringing with it a greater degree of flexibility.

What are a few of the key characteristics of modern business organisation today? Well, one concept that has definitely had a big impact on modern business organisation is Environmental, Social and Governance. What is Environmental, Social and Governance? Basically, Environmental, Social and Governance is a conceptual structure for internal and external business practice. It covers a variety of business problems, from infrastructure to responsible investment, with its impact clearly being felt across many different business sectors. One of the most prominent elements of Environmental, Social and Governance (generally described by its acronym, ESG) is its focus on sustainability. In essence, sustainability has to do with environmental awareness vis-à-vis business advancement. Undoubtedly, sustainability has actually emerged for numerous companies as being amongst the essential characteristics of business strategy. This environmental emphasis on business strategy can be seen throughout several sectors. For example, in the shipping market, companies are tackling investing in vehicles that can operate on renewable energy sources. Digital supply chains are likewise showing to increase effectiveness and therefore, decrease environmental pollution. In the farming sector, meanwhile, digital innovation is showing helpful in the form of sensors, with such tools being able to monitor crop health and by effect, lower ecological waste. Organic farming is a fantastic example of a prevalent and esteemed sustainable business practice; not just is it much better for soil irrigation and surrounding ecosystems, however it also can cause agritourism chances for rural communities.
